The Ludwik Zamenhof Centre in Białystok honors the ophthalmologist and linguist who invented Esperanto, the world's most widely spoken constructed language. Housed in a modern building near Zamenhof's birthplace, the centre features interactive exhibits on his life, the history of Esperanto, and the multicultural heritage of Białystok. Visitors can explore multilingual displays, a library of Esperanto literature, and temporary art exhibitions. The centre also hosts workshops and events promoting linguistic diversity.

Don't miss

  • Interactive exhibits on Zamenhof's life and the creation of Esperanto
  • Library with over 20,000 volumes in Esperanto and other languages
  • Temporary art exhibitions linking language and culture
